    Grueter wins maiden 3i Africa Summit Invitational Golf tournament

    Former captain of the Achimota Golf Club, Sjoerd Grueter, shrugged off stiff competition from a field of cracked golfers to win the maiden 3i Africa Summit Invitational Golf Tournament played at the Achimota Golf Course on Tuesday.

    The one-day 18-hole Stableford event was organised to herald the 3i Africa Summit 2026 in Accra and to celebrate the 58th birthday of the Governor of the Bank of Ghana, Dr Johnson Pandit Asiama.

    Over 100 amateur golfers from various clubs in Ghana and across Africa featured in the championship.

    In the Men’s group A category, Sjoerd Grueter playing Handicap 9 garnered 30 Stableford points, to beat Isaac Aninakwah and Solomon Allotey both of whom played Handicap 8 and 9 respectively to earn 38 Stableford points apiece.

    In the Men’s group B category, Moses Kanduri took first position with 38 Stableford points with Handicap 20, Max Ernst Heinrich playing Handicap 14 beat Charles Ofori on countback to place second after both grabbed 38 points apiece.

    In the Ladies group A category, Vastie Amoafo-Yeboah playing at Handicap 12, stole the show with 34 Stableford points to beat Princess Nkansah-Boadu on countback while Emma Bulley followed in third with 32 points at Handicap of 12.

    Playing at Handicap 26, Anita Ohene Mantey bagged 41 points to beat Akua Tamakloe (40 points) and Christine Furler (38 points) to second and third places respectively in the Ladies group B category.

    In the visitors men’s category, Joe Mucheru playing Handicap 24, grabbed 38 Stableford points to win while Nshuti Mbabazi played Handicap 26 to bag home 34 points.

    Yaw Afriyie picked home the longest drive (hole 15) while that of the women went to Letitia Amponsah-Mensah with the men’s closest to the pin (hole 18) went to Sjoerd Grueter with Helen Appah winning that of the women.

    Dr Asiama, who performed the official tee-off, congratulated the golfers for coming out in their numbers on an unusual golfing day to make the tournament a huge success.

    He tasked the Ghana Golf Association (GGA) and the Achimota Golf Club to explore avenues to make it possible for Ghana to host a world tournament within the next three years.

    According to him, Ghana is a great destination for prestigious sports like golf, and a great course like the Achimota Golf course can host the rest of the world.

    “For us at the Bank of Ghana, we feel that this is a good initiative to support. Just as we are supporting the 3i Africa Invitational Golf Tournament, we will also support such a worthy cause,” he indicated.
